I know nothing about cameras but it is dads birthday coming up and he mentioned he needed a new SD card.

So I do not want to get a cheap and nasty card as it is a gift, any good makes out there, any I need to avoid?

He is only a holiday snapper so no need for the latest or greatest.

First off you need to know what camera he has and what capacity cards it is compatible with. If you have the make and model then you can get this information from the web.

As for cards the best to get are the name brand ones: SanDisk, Lexar, Panasonic are my picks. And in the SanDisk the Extreme III are the best middle of the road ones.

If you buy off eBay (or similar) there is also a good reference on eBay about how to make sure its a genuine card and not a cheap Chinese copy.
